Ultrastructure of egg shell of four different Coccoidea species in Egypt
I Abdel-Razak Soad1, Sahar M Beshr, A K Mourad
1Agricultural Research Centre, Alexandria, Egypt.
Abstract:
The present study was initiated to perform a comparative measurements of egg dimension and structure of four different species pertaining to three families of the super family: Coccoidea. These species were: Mycetaspis personata (Comstock) (Diaspididae), Ceroplastes floridensis (Comstock) (Coccidae), Pulvinaria psidii (Maskell) (Coccidae), and Icerya seychellarum seychellarum (Westw.) (Margarodidae). The studied species differed in their means of egg laying and chorion structure, which may explain the mode of insect protection. The dimensions of chorion shell, as well as the ultra structure of the egg shell of each species were examined and discussed.
